Cumulative incidence and risk factors for radiation induced leukoencephalopathy in high grade glioma long term survivors

Abstract: The incidence and risk factors associated with radiation-induced leukoencephalopathy (RIL) in long-term survivors of high-grade glioma (HGG) are still poorly investigated. We performed a retrospective research in our institutional database for patients with supratentorial HGG treated with focal radiotherapy, having a progression-free overall survival > 30 months and available germline DNA. “…Following multimodal treatment in glioma patients, fiber connections may become disrupted by structural tissue damage resulting from tumor resection, radiotherapy, alkylating chemotherapy, or combinations thereof ( 10 13 ), or by recurrent tumor growth ( 14 ). Apart from the fiber tracts originating in the primary, eloquent cortical regions, tissue damage may affect larger and wider distributed white matter areas ( 15 17 ) involving structural connections of multiple functional networks ( 18 ). Therefore, glioma patients often develop deficits in cognition, general performance ( 19 ), and quality of life that increase with the duration of survival and intensity of therapy ( 15 , 20 ).…”
